SERIOUS CHARGE
GARDNER’S OFFENCE THREE YEARS’ DETENTION*. = [Per Press Association.) HAMILTON, June 10. A sentence of a year’s imprisonment with hard labour, to be followed by two years’ reformative detention, was given Henry Morris, a married expoliceman and head gardner at the Tokanui Mental Hospital, by Mr Justice Herdman to-day, for attempted rape of a 17-year-old girL
